Transaction 3e66478dd9ad6ffd08b2c511f0e07776f4ee2fde28c1374f43f455fa01d80ebc

1 Input
2 Outputs
  • 3e66478dd9ad6ffd08b2c511f0e07776f4ee2fde28c1374f43f455fa01d80ebc:0
  • value  4134630
    address  3446X7Pq1dYG7a91s7q7mhnY8rZd6Soa7Y
  • 3e66478dd9ad6ffd08b2c511f0e07776f4ee2fde28c1374f43f455fa01d80ebc:1
  • value  16269450081
    address  37xtbyRRxXa3RzsBFF3Z4SahN378MPbwLk